What is the difference between Asst Program Manager vs Project Coordinator?

AspectAsst Program ManagerProject Coordinator
CredentialsBachelor's degree, PMP or similar certifications often preferredBachelor's degree, certifications less common
Work EnvironmentOversees multiple projects within a program, strategic focusSupports individual projects, operational focus
Employer & Industry UsageUsed in industries like IT, construction, healthcareCommon across various industries, including marketing and tech
Search & Comparison IntentUnderstanding higher-level responsibilities and qualificationsClarifying support roles and daily tasks

The Asst Program Manager typically oversees multiple projects within a program, focusing on strategic coordination and higher-level management. In contrast, a Project Coordinator supports specific projects with operational tasks. Both roles require similar educational backgrounds, but the Asst Program Manager often holds additional certifications and has broader responsibilities.

Program Assistant
Job Purpose:
The Program Administrator works closely with the Program Manager and with various team members, to meet program delivery goals. Maintains direct contact with customers and with operations personnel to ensure positive relationships are maintained and customer expectations are met.

  • Provide support to the Program Management team
  • Utilize advanced computer skills to extract, analyze, compile, and distribute data.
  • Use positive human relations skills to successfully deal directly with internal and external customers
  • Research information to help the Program Managers answer product concerns
  • Assist the Program Managers in their handling of complaints, suggestions, and problems concerning the company's products, determine what action is required, and help to coordinate the activities required to solve the problem
  • Communicate to customers by composing accurate, prompt and effective replies to routine letters, e-mail, and phone calls.
  • Handle difficult or sensitive issues.
  • Explain technical information in an easy to understand manner
  • Perform data input in a highly accurate and timely manner according to information parameters.
Nature of Duties/Responsibilities:
  • High School Diploma
  • 1 - 3 years Customer service experience
  • Organized, focused, and able to multi-task
  • Oral and written communication
  • Routine communication with Customer and internal personnel
  • Demonstrated proficiency with Microsoft Excel, Word and PowerPoint applications
  • Experience with Oracle a plus
  • Routine reporting of financial and quality performance data
  • Researching problems and coordinating corrective action
  • Customer-first attitude
